当前位置:万大网络百科信息网 >> 软件知识 >> 人工智能 >> 详情

软件技术创新助力人工智能快速发展研究

软件技术创新助力人工智能快速发展研究

随着信息时代的推进,人工智能(AI)已成为全球科技竞争的核心领域,其快速发展离不开软件技术创新的强力支撑。从算法优化到计算平台,再到数据处理工具,软件技术的每一次突破都为AI的演进注入了新动力。本文旨在探讨软件技术如何助力AI的快速发展,并结合结构化数据进行分析,以期为相关研究提供参考。

人工智能的兴起源于多个因素,但软件技术创新在其中扮演了关键角色。早期AI研究受限于计算能力和算法效率,但随着深度学习框架的出现,如TensorFlow和PyTorch,研究人员得以快速构建和训练复杂模型。这些软件工具不仅提供了灵活的编程接口,还优化了底层计算,使得AI模型的开发周期大大缩短。例如,TensorFlow由谷歌于2015年推出,其分布式计算功能支持大规模数据处理,从而加速了机器学习应用的落地。此外,开源社区的活跃促进了软件技术的共享与迭代,进一步推动了AI的普及。

在计算平台方面,云计算GPU加速技术为AI提供了可扩展的资源。云计算平台如AWS、Azure和谷歌云,通过虚拟化技术提供了弹性的计算和存储服务,降低了AI开发的成本和门槛。据统计,全球云计算市场在2020年已达到数千亿美元规模,其中AI服务占比逐年上升。GPU作为并行计算的核心硬件,其驱动软件和编程模型(如CUDA)的优化,使得AI训练速度提升了数十倍。这种软硬件结合的模式,使得人工智能能够在医疗、金融和自动驾驶等领域实现快速应用。

数据处理是AI发展的另一基石,大数据软件工具在此发挥了重要作用。Hadoop和Spark等分布式计算框架,能够高效处理海量数据,为AI模型提供高质量的训练数据集。同时,数据库软件如NoSQL和NewSQL,支持非结构化和实时数据的存储与查询,增强了AI系统的适应能力。以下表格展示了一些关键软件技术对AI发展的贡献数据,这些数据基于行业报告和研究文献,体现了结构化分析的价值。

软件技术推出时间对AI发展的主要贡献影响指数(1-10分)
TensorFlow2015年提供灵活的深度学习框架,支持分布式训练,加速模型部署9
PyTorch2016年动态计算图设计,便于研究和实验,提升开发效率8
云计算平台(AWS AI服务)2006年起逐步推出提供可扩展计算资源,降低AI开发成本,促进应用落地9
CUDA编程模型2007年优化GPU并行计算,显著提升AI训练和推理速度8
Apache Spark2014年高效处理大数据,支持实时分析,为AI提供数据基础7

除了上述核心技术,软件生态系统的完善也为AI发展创造了良好环境。开源项目如Scikit-learn和Keras,简化了机器学习流程,吸引了更多开发者参与。API和微服务架构的普及,使得AI功能能够轻松集成到现有系统中,推动了产业智能化。例如,在自然语言处理领域,基于Transformer架构的软件库(如Hugging Face Transformers)提供了预训练模型,大幅降低了NLP应用的门槛。这些创新不仅加速了AI技术的传播,还催生了新的商业模式,如AI-as-a-Service(AIaaS)。

扩展来看,软件技术创新正助力AI向更广泛领域渗透。在医疗健康中,AI软件辅助诊断系统通过图像识别算法,提高了疾病检测的准确性;在自动驾驶中,实时感知软件结合传感器数据,实现了车辆智能决策。然而,这也带来了挑战,如数据隐私和算法偏见问题,需要软件技术进一步优化框架和安全机制。未来,随着边缘计算量子软件的发展,AI有望在低延迟和高性能场景中取得更大突破,软件创新将继续成为驱动力量。

综上所述,软件技术创新通过算法框架、计算平台和数据处理工具等多维度贡献,显著促进了人工智能的快速发展。结构化数据表明,关键软件技术不仅在技术上提升了效率,还在生态上推动了普及。展望未来,持续的软件研发和跨学科合作,将帮助AI克服现有局限,实现更智能、更可靠的应用,为社会经济发展注入新动能。本文的分析强调了软件与AI的协同演进,为后续研究提供了基础视角。

标签:人工智能